Dáil Éireann Debate, Thursday - 31 January 2013

Thursday, 31 January 2013

Questions (88)

Billy Kelleher

Question:

88. Deputy Billy Kelleher asked the Minister for Public Expenditure and Reform if he will provide in tabular form the number of organisations or agencies under the aegis of his Department that have vacancies on their board; the length of time any such vacancies have been unfilled; the number of vacancies that have been advertised; the number of applications to fill such vacancies that have been received;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[4864/13]

View answer

Written answers

In response to the Deputy’s question the following table outlines the number of organisations or agencies under the remit of my Department that currently have vacancies on their Boards:

-

Board Vacancies

Length of time vacancy unfilled

Vacancy advertised

Applications received for vacancy

An Post National Lottery

One

One year and three months approximately.

No

None

Outside Appointments Board

One

2 months.

No

None

The Chair of the Outside Appointments Board resigned on 22nd November 2012 so it has been vacant for two months. My Department has not advertised for the post (which has no remuneration attaching to it) but is in the process of seeking potentially suitable candidates with a view to making a selection. The current National Lottery license is due to expire in 2013.
